CIVIL REVOLUTION: WHO AM I? WHY AM I HERE?

 

By God’s grace, I have changed, am changing, and will continue to change as I interact with my fellow travelers on this planet. A main reason for that transformation is to honor God by being a blessing to those I’m sojourning alongside. A fundamental key to making that a reality is examining my own life first. I need to continually learn and understand my own narrative, the reasons I think, speak, and act the way I do. Then I am better positioned to love my neighbors well by helping make the world a better place through honest, open communication. 

Over many years, I’ve found myself looking at my interaction with my fellow travelers on life’s road through three primary lenses: Saint, Sufferer, and Sinner.* In so doing, I have found that I am better able to read beyond the cover of the book readily visible to me (mine and others) in order to attempt to comprehend who my neighbors are with a feature-length film rather than merely a snapshot or one passing moment in their lives. In essence, I seek to understand the worldview that propels them to think, speak, and act the way they do. In this way, I am better prepared to understand the foundation upon which their identity is built and why they believe they’ve been placed on this planet. Then I will be able to have a more compelling conversation with them rather than monologuing at them.
